Bruno Fernandes explains what went wrong for Man United in embarrassing defeat to Palace

Manchester United captain Bruno Fernandes has blamed his side’s lack of aggression on their 2-0 defeat at the hands of Crystal Palace.

Jean-Philippe Mateta’s second-half brace condemned United to an 11th top-flight loss of the campaign.

The result also saw United drop down to 13th position in the Premier League table, with Palace leapfrogging them.

After the final whistle, Fernandes spoke to MUTV and had his say on the match and what went wrong for the Red Devils on their own turf.

He said, “Of course, we spoke after the games that we won that, everything we do in the past will be forgotten, if we do not win the next one.”

“Today is the case and everyone [knew] what had to focus on this one to get three points in the Premier League.”

“Everyone was aware of that and it is a different competition where we have and needed to win to get three points. Unfortunately, today, we didn’t get the three points.”

The Portugal international added, “We lacked a little bit of aggression to get into the final third and try something to score goals.”

“We need the players we have in front to get more goals, to create more and we need to be able to take players on to get goals from that. We did have some chances but not as many as we should have.”

Fernandes emphasised the importance of positive results on team confidence.

“You build with the results and, when you win you games, you get more confident. Obviously, we won the last two games and everyone was pretty confident on what we [do] as everyone believes more when you are winning games in what you are doing.”

“For us, now it is a setback but we need to understand we have been doing good things and, even today, we showed some good things. Obviously, the result doesn’t show that but we need to be aware that we can achieve a lot with the things that we have been doing.”

United are back in action on Friday when they host Ruud van Nistelrooy’s Leicester City in the fourth round of the FA Cup.
